NAME

       unrar-free - extract files from rar archives

SYNOPSIS

       unrar-free   [-xtfp?V]    [--extract]    [--list]    [--force]   [--extract-newer]   [--extract-no-paths]
       [--password]  [--help]  [--usage]  [--version] ARCHIVE  [FILE ...]  [DESTINATION]

DESCRIPTION

       unrar-free is a program for extracting files from rar archives.

OPTIONS

       These programs follow the usual GNU command line syntax, with  long  options  starting  with  two  dashes
       (`-').  A summary of options is included below.

       -x,  --extract
              Extract files from archive (default).

       -t,  --list
              List files in archive.

       -f,  --force
              Overwrite files when extracting.

       --extract-newer
              Only extract newer files from the archive.

       --extract-no-paths
              Don't create directories while extracting.

       -p,  --password
              Decrypt archive using a password.

       -?,  --help
              Show program help.

       --usage
              Show short program usage message.

       -V,  --version
              Show version of program.

NON-FREE UNRAR COMPATIBLE SYNOPSIS

       unrar-free [elvx]  [-ep]  [-o+]  [-o-]  [-pPassword]  [-u]  [--] ARCHIVE  [FILE ...]  [DESTINATION]

       This  syntax should only be used in front-end programs which use the non-free unrar as a back-end.  It is
       recommended to use this program by GNU command line syntax.

NON-FREE UNRAR COMPATIBLE OPTIONS

       e      Extract files from archive without full path.

       l      List files in archive.

       v      Verbosely list files in archive.

       x      Extract files from archive with full path.

       -ep    Don't create directories while extracting.

       -o+    Overwrite files when extracting.

       -o-    Don't overwrite files when extracting.

       -pPassword
              Decrypt archive using the password Password.

       -u     Only extract newer files from the archive.

       -y     Assume Yes on all queries.  Ineffective.

       --     Disable further switch processing.  Any switch after the -- is treated as filename or destination.
